Hospice launches respite day care service

.
4th September 2019
We've launched a brand new respite day care service to give carers a much needed day off.

Lindsey Lodge Hospice’s Daybreak Service operates from its Wellbeing Centre every Monday, between 10am and 3pm, offering personalised, non-medical care for North Lincolnshire adults who are unable to be left alone for long periods of time.

Staffed by a mixture of clinical staff and volunteer ‘buddies’, service users are invited to stay for the whole day, or places are bookable by the hour.

Lindsey Lodge Hospice Wellbeing Centre Manager Sarah Hodge said: “Even the most dedicated carer deserves a day off sometimes.

“Our Daybreak Service cares for a loved one in a safe, warm and welcoming environment, while a carer takes a little break from their usual routine.”

She added: “This is a new paid for respite service running every Monday.

“We offer a range of mentally stimulating and therapeutic activities, which encourage interaction, exercise, socialising, both in our Wellbeing Centre and our beautiful gardens and accept bookings from anyone aged 18 years and over, with neurological and life limiting conditions including dementia, which mean they are unable to be left alone for long periods of time.”

A full day in Lindsey Lodge’s Daybreak Service, inclusive refreshments and a three-course lunch costs £60 per day. Bookings are also available on an hourly basis at £15 per hour.

Sarah added: “All people need to do is phone, or email us and we will contact them and invite them and their loved one to visit us for an assessment at Lindsey Lodge, or we can visit them at home, when we will then discuss opportunities and availability for our Daybreak Service.

“During their loved one’s time using our Daybreak Service, both service users and carers will both have an opportunity to access a range of other activities and complementary therapies, beauty treatments, which are bookable and payable through the Daybreak Team. We can also arrange for carers to talk to a carer support professional here at Lindsey Lodge.”
